Crypto news:
- State Street finds institutional investors eye doubling their digital asset exposure within three years
- Institutions no longer focus on market capitalization but instead follow a nuanced, stock market-like investing strategy in digital asset markets, according to Bitwise’s Hunter Horsley.
- The U.K. has ended its ban on crypto exchange-traded notes, letting retail investors hold bitcoin and ether ETNs tax-free in pension and ISA accounts.
- Crypto exchange Coinbase and payments giant Mastercard have each held advanced acquisition talks to buy BVNK, a London-based fintech that builds stablecoin payment infrastructure, according to six people familiar with the matter who spoke with Fortune.
- Ripple to bring RLUSD stablecoin to Bahrain via new partnership
- Solana treasury company Sharps Technology is partnering with Coinbase Global to boost its SOL accumulation strategy.
- Digital Currency Group subsidiary Yuma, focused on scaling the decentralized AI network Bittensor TAO launching an asset management division
